Last night the City Council approved the City Manager’s recommendation to appropriate $600k for shoreline and Powder Magazine patio improvements at the park. Huzzah! This is FABULOUS news because it will inspire the State, once again, to invest at Magazine Beach.
As you know, the Mass. Department of Conservation & Recreation (DCR) is responsible for almost a half million acres and its current funding is at 89% of its 2009 level. To make improvements at the park, DCR needs partners. And the City of Cambridge has been an excellent one.
Look for a ribbon cutting at the canoe/kayak launch late this spring, and soon thereafter, a groundbreaking and construction along the river and around the Magazine.
